Good luck with your rebuild. Though people often criticise the Haynes manual for 2CVs it is a good starting point for you.
Parts are going to be your problem. There is a massive difficulty for UK and European parts suppliers selling into the US and Canada because of your unlimited liability laws. In fact when I was involved with the 2CV club in the UK we were specifically advised not to sell parts across the pond by our insurers.
I think what a lot of your countrymen do is have a pet friend in Europe buy parts on their behalf and send them over.
